G8 FMs urge DPRK to refrain from 'further provocative acts'

G8 foreign ministers urged the Democratic People's Republic of Korea (DPRK) to "refrain from further provocative acts," on Thursday.

The foreign ministers issued a joint statement following their meetings in London, expressing commitments on preventing and ending global and regional conflicts.

On the Korean Peninsula situation, the foreign ministers "condemned in the strongest possible terms" the continued development of its nuclear weapons and ballistic missile programs by the DPRK, the statement said.

The foreign ministers supported the commitment to strengthen the current sanctions regime and take further significant measures in the event of a further launch or nuclear test by the DPRK.

They condemned DPRK's current aggressive rhetoric, and urged the country to engage in credible and authentic multilateral talks on denuclearization and refrain from further provocative acts.
